My Buying Guides on White Heat Shrink Tubing
What I Look for First
When I buy white heat shrink tubing, I start by checking the size, shrink ratio, and material quality. I want tubing that will fit snugly over the wire or cable before shrinking, then tighten evenly with heat. For me, the most important thing is making sure the tubing is suitable for the project, whether I’m organizing wires, insulating connections, or giving a clean finished look.
Material Matters
I always pay attention to the material because it affects durability and performance. Most of the time, I prefer polyolefin because it shrinks smoothly, resists wear, and works well for general electrical use. If I need something for tougher conditions, I look for tubing with better heat resistance or added protection. I also make sure the white color is consistent and not too translucent if appearance matters.
Choosing the Right Size
Sizing is one of the biggest things I check before buying. I measure the wire or object I want to cover and compare it to the tubing’s expanded diameter and recovered diameter. I usually choose a size that slides on easily before shrinking but still gives a tight seal after heating. If I’m covering connectors or solder joints, I make sure there’s enough room for the joint without stretching the tubing too much.
Heat Shrink Ratio
I look at the shrink ratio because it tells me how much the tubing will contract. A 2:1 ratio works well for many simple jobs, but I sometimes choose 3:1 if I need more flexibility in fit. The higher the ratio, the more versatile the tubing tends to be. I like having that extra room when I’m working with uneven shapes or slightly larger connectors.
Wall Thickness and Protection
Wall thickness is another detail I never ignore. Thicker tubing usually gives better abrasion resistance and more protection, while thinner tubing is easier to work with in tight spaces. I decide based on the job: if I want a neat finish and basic insulation, thinner tubing is fine; if I need more strength, I go thicker.
Temperature Rating
I always check the temperature rating before I buy. I want tubing that can handle the heat from the shrinking process and any heat the application may generate later. If I’m using it near electronics or automotive wiring, I make sure the tubing can stand up to the environment without softening or cracking.
Appearance and Finish
Since I’m buying white heat shrink tubing, appearance matters to me more than with standard black tubing. I look for a clean, bright white finish that stays neat after shrinking. I also prefer tubing that doesn’t yellow easily over time, especially if it will be visible in a finished project.
Electrical and Safety Needs
If I’m using the tubing for electrical work, I make sure it has proper insulation properties and meets the needs of the project. I don’t want to guess when it comes to safety. I also check whether the tubing is flame-retardant or rated for specific applications if I’m using it in a more demanding setup.
Pack Size and Value
I think about how much I actually need before I buy. Sometimes a small pack is enough for a one-time repair, but if I do a lot of wiring work, I prefer a larger pack for better value. I compare the price per length rather than just the total price so I know I’m getting a fair deal.
My Final Buying Tip
My best advice is to buy white heat shrink tubing based on the exact job, not just the color. I always match the size, shrink ratio, material, and temperature rating to my project. When I do that, I get a cleaner finish, better protection, and a result that lasts.
